Output 5290181fcf180239b77c62e22ec35377a654a83a32d4c3d280a0d4b768a86837:1

value
886839
script pubkey
OP_0 OP_PUSHBYTES_20 93e2c2cc2959694d18a4ff24f19a81fbe9f7598a
address
bc1qj03v9npft9556x9yluj0rx5pl05lwkv2l5007u
transaction
5290181fcf180239b77c62e22ec35377a654a83a32d4c3d280a0d4b768a86837
confirmations
327314
spent
true